Ohio Breweries Fight Confusing Hemp Laws | Columbus News
Ohio breweries are furious as new state laws suddenly classify their THC drinks as cannabis, banning sales outside dispensaries—even though they’re made the same way as products sold by friends. Co-founder Collin Castore calls it absurd, urging listeners to join “Save Ohio Beverages” to fix the mess. Ten companies are temporarily allowed to sell while lawsuits play out, arguing the law conflicts with federal Farm Bill protections. But looming federal changes in November could make most of these drinks illegal anyway, threatening jobs and revenue across the state. Support the show:Get a…
